A woman from North Carolina dialed 911 and complained that pulled pork was “undercooked” when brought to her.




Because her pulled pork at Clyde Cooper’s BBQ restaurant was pink, the customer, Annie Cooke, decided to phone the Raleigh police. The owner of the establishment, Debbie Holt, said she found the incident amusing since she informed Cooke that smoked barbequed pork turns pink, but the customer insisted that her meal wasn’t cooked thoroughly enough. Cooke was allowed to switch to white chicken, but she fled the establishment and dialed 911 immediately.

“Every barbecue I’ve had is all the way done; you don’t see pink at all,” she explained. “I asked if they could cook it some more, that I’m not eating any pink barbecue. They said it’s supposed to be pink, but I’ve never had it that way,” Cooke explained to The News & Observer.
